Help With Nitrous

I was about to invest in a nitrous kit on a fully stock LS3 but before I did I had a few questions I was wondering about that hopefully some nitrous experts could help me with.

1) What is the difference between a wet and dry shot and what is ideal ?
2) What shot can the LS3 handle without causing major reliability issues ? 100-150-200 etc.
3) Where is the best place to hide/place the bottle so it isn't easily visible or noticeable ? I can get a bracket or something welded to the chassis if there is a safe spot somewhere.

Thank you for any help/advice it is much appreciated and welcomed. If I forgot to ask any major question that you think I should know please just leave a FYI.

Nice read.Thanks for the link flyer08. Ran Spray in the the early 80's and you did nothing but turn bottle on hit red button and hang on.Many 1/4 and Street runs and never had an issue. Things are so much better today with all the electronics/safety gizmos but it still seems like many people are afraid of Nitrous and you can't find a lot of info.

That Nitrous Outlet Gen5 Camaro Setup is a great Wet Hardline Setup.They do make a Rearwall Bracket Mouting Plate for the Camaro Trunk that Bolts right in for a Clean Setup.
http://www.nitrousoutlet.com/2010-ca...e-bracket.html

In the link one thing observed is that the Company that made that neat idea "Black Box" in the pic is no longer in business. Was searching for info and read it somewhere. :(

My car's Nitrous system is being setup for 1/2 mile Runs. Ran the new Engine for the first time last month in the 1/2 and ran great but just ran out of air at High DA 4-6k and track to get the heavy azz moving. Needs a little boost. The Builder VR is using Nitrous Outlet for almost everything shown in that link.Have to a do a little light fabrication due to aftermarket Fuel Rails on a different Motor which is built for Spray. Also looks like we are going to go with a dual bottle setup in trunk. Going with the NOS Laucher Controller instead of the Mini for ease of use/datalogging at Track.
